Rising pop star Audrey Hobert has officially launched her 'Staircase to Stardom' tour, supporting her debut album 'Who’s the Clown?' Released via RCA Records, the album is receiving critical acclaim as Hobert showcases her multifaceted tale...
Audrey Hobert's 'Staircase to Stardom' tour marks a significant milestone in her burgeoning career. With stops across the United States, United Kingdom, Europe, Australia and New Zealand, the tour aims to bring her unique brand of bubblegum pop to a global audience. Her performances, known for their theatricality and emotionally charged delivery, are expected to draw both longtime fans and new listeners. The simultaneous release of the 'Sex and the City' music video further amplifies her artistic presence, revealing a deeper layer of storytelling and visual creativity. Hobert's journey from co-writing with Gracie Abrams to headlining her own tour highlights her growth and determination in the music industry. Her ability to blend catchy pop melodies with self-aware lyrics has resonated with critics and fans alike, setting the stage for continued success.
